    Solid-state relays (SSR) utilize semiconductor devices for switching control, eliminating mechanical wear and contact oxidation issues inherent in electromechanical relays. However, in practical applications, latent factors such as heat accumulation, long-term aging, and environmental wear can still cause SSR performance degradation or sudden failures, compromising circuit system stability.     What is DC-DC Converter?

    In modern electronic devices, different circuit modules often require different voltages to operate properly. For example, a microprocessor may require a stable 1.2V core voltage, a touchscreen may require a 3.3V drive voltage, and a motor may require 12V or even higher. However, our power supplies—whether batteries, adapters, or solar panels—typically only provide a fixed voltage (such as a 5V USB port or a 12V battery). So, how can we obtain these diverse, stable, and precise voltages from a single power source? The answer is the DC-DC converter.
